Building the Domestic Church
The term “Domestic Church” refers to the family, the smallest body of gathered believers in Christ. Our Early Church Fathers understood that the home was fertile ground for discipleship, sanctification, and holiness.
In order to live our Christian lives most fully, the Catholic Church teaches us to live out our discipleship first and foremost with those closest to us in our lives.
